微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

json字符串能长多少

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它以文本形式表达数据,具有易读性、易于解析和易于生成的特点。在Web开发中,JSON被广泛应用于数据交换和前后端数据通信。其中,JSON字符串是最基础的数据格式。那么,JSON字符串能长多少呢?

{
    "name":"张三","age":20,"hobbies":["足球","篮球","游泳"],"address":{
        "province":"广东省","city":"广州市","district":"天河区"
    }
}

json字符串能长多少

以上是一个简单的JSON字符串示例,它包含了一个名为“张三”的人的一些基本信息。在JSON字符串中,字符串值被双引号包围,数字、布尔值、空值、数组和对象都可以成为JSON数据的一部分。

实际上,JSON字符串的长度没有明确的限制,主要受到以下几个因素的影响:

  • 字符串编码:JSON字符串的编码方式决定了它可以包含多少个字符。常见的编码方式有UTF-8、UTF-16和UTF-32等。
  • 协议限制:有些协议对字符串长度有限制,例如GET请求的URL长度,WebSocket消息的大小等。
  • 服务器资源:当JSON字符串过长时,服务器需要分配更多的内存来处理它,因此服务器的资源也是限制JSON字符串长度的因素之一。

虽然JSON字符串的长度没有明确的限制,但为了保证数据的传输速度和服务器的处理效率,通常建议将JSON字符串控制在几KB以内。

总之,JSON字符串能长多少,取决于多个因素,需要根据具体情况灵活掌控。在实际开发中,需要根据数据的大小和传输速度等要素来考虑JSON字符串的长度。

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。

相关推荐